Wellness Defined:
According to www.dictionary.com wellness is defined as:
1. the quality or state of being healthy in body and mind, esp. as the result of deliberate effort.
2. an approach to healthcare that emphasizes preventing illness and prolonging life, as opposed to emphasizing treating diseases.
Our approach to wellness is a holistic, there are 5 areas that make up our life: Mental, Physical, Family (Relationships), Society and Finances.
If one area is out of balance, the other areas are affected. Every aspect of our lives are interdependent and mutually significant. Wellness is not just about eating well or exercising (those are important)...we are now starting to realize our lives are not just external, we are also being called to cultivate our internal world. To live from within, to align every aspect of ourselves.
